Pretty much the same mold as I mentioned earlier. Differences besides color were the head, the two metal bars on Huffer's forearm, chest piece, crotch and some mini-dots present on Huff's wheels. Both can exchange each other's weapons. It was here where I looked at Huffer and realized man he looked good here. His colors are outstanding and vibrant. I wasn't too thrilled when I first got him but he is starting to grow on me now. However, I do feel Pipe's weapons are more fun to employ then Huffer's Shield and rifle.

Conclusion
Overall, Pipes is a good figure. No qualms if you already enjoyed Huffer. Pipes fits well to the G1 classics line up. I do like his blues/whites though it is somewhat overshadowed by a more colorful Huffer. Pipes does have the better weapons and it can be toggled and placed in however you choose. That it's for now.
